Is Your Server Under Attack? Identifying and Preventing IP Stresser Exploits

Your server might be dealing with an attack – specifically, an IP stresser exploit. These applications attempt to flood your server's bandwidth by sending a huge amount of requests, potentially resulting in outages or even a complete crash. Recognizing the signs is important; look for unusual spikes in traffic volume, slow response times, and warnings related to resource exhaustion. Prevention involves implementing traffic filtering measures, utilizing a strong firewall, and regularly auditing your system performance. Keeping your operating system and security patches up-to-date is also absolutely necessary in minimizing your exposure to these malicious exploits.
